New Mexico Percentage of Renters Paying $1500-$2000 County Rank

Based on ACS 2006-2010 data*

A total of 16 results found. Show Results on Map.

RankPercentage of Renters Paying $1500-$2000 ▼County / Population
1.7.1%Santa Fe, NM / 141,702
2.5.5%Sandoval, NM / 124,263
3.4.5%Los Alamos, NM / 18,091
4.2.9%San Juan, NM / 127,517
5.2.7%Otero, NM / 62,782
6.2.4%Colfax, NM / 13,827
7.2.1%Bernalillo, NM / 646,881
8.2.0%Dona Ana, NM / 201,670
9.1.7%Lea, NM / 62,503
10.1.1%Eddy, NM / 52,665
11.0.8%Valencia, NM / 74,554
12.0.6%Chaves, NM / 64,268
12.0.6%Taos, NM / 32,574
14.0.5%Roosevelt, NM / 19,372
15.0.4%Rio Arriba, NM / 40,195
16.0.3%San Miguel, NM / 29,321

Please note that we only rank locations with 'Percentage of Renters Paying $1500-$2000' data. The rank above might not be a complete list. Locations without 'Percentage of Renters Paying $1500-$2000' data are not listed.

*ACS stands for U.S. Census American Community Survey. According to the U.S. Census, if the date is a range, you can interpret the data as an average of the period of time.
